| Inscribed large stele with pediment top.
In the pediment is a small urn; below, on the stele proper, a wreath.
Inscribed above and below the wreath, but letters almost totally illegible except for the ... 163/2 B.C ... I 73 ... I 73 |

| Inscription on building block.
Back preserved, dressed smooth, and right side with anathyrosis.
Four lines of the inscription preserved.
Pentelic marble. Found in marble pile, in the area west of the Stoa ... End of 3rd. century B.C ... Hesperia 26 (1957), p. 218, no. 73, pl. 56. |
